A Look at Michael Clarke Duncan's Life
Michael Clarke Duncan came into the world on December 10, 1957, in Chicago, Illinois. His early years were shaped by being raised by a single mother, which is that a pretty common story for many people. His mother, apparently, had some thoughts about his future, especially when it came to playing football. She wasn't too keen on him pursuing that particular sport, and that stance, in a way, actually led him down a different path entirely.
This early guidance from his mother, interestingly enough, played a part in his decision to become an actor. It's almost like a twist of fate, you know? Instead of hitting the football field, he decided to pursue a career in acting, which is a very different kind of stage. He also spent some time studying at Kankakee Community College, which certainly helped him get a good foundation for whatever he wanted to do next. His journey into acting wasn't immediate, but it was a path he eventually found.
Before he truly broke through in the acting world, Michael Clarke Duncan took on various jobs. He was, for instance, a bodyguard for a time, which makes a lot of sense given his size. This experience, in some respects, probably gave him a lot of insight into different kinds of people and situations, which could only help his acting later on. He was, basically, building a life, always working towards something bigger.

Sadly, Michael Clarke Duncan passed away on September 3, 2012, at the age of 54. His passing was due to natural causes, following a heart attack he had experienced in July of that same year. It was a really sad moment for many who admired his work and his gentle spirit. His life, though not as long as many might have wished, was certainly full of impactful performances and a truly memorable presence on screen, as a matter of fact.
Personal Details and Bio Data
Here's a quick look at some key details about Michael Clarke Duncan:
Detail | Information |
---|---|
Full Name | Michael Clarke Duncan |
Born | December 10, 1957 |
Died | September 3, 2012 |
Age at Death | 54 years old |
Birthplace | Chicago, Illinois, USA |
Education | Kankakee Community College |
Occupation | Actor, Voice Actor |
Height | 6 ft 4 ¼ inches (193.7 cm) |
The Unforgettable Role in "The Green Mile"
When you think of Michael Clarke Duncan, one role likely comes to mind almost immediately: John Coffey in the film "The Green Mile." This part, truly, became a defining moment in his acting career. He played a character who was very, very big in size but possessed a profoundly gentle and innocent spirit, which was quite a contrast. The film itself, as a matter of fact, really resonated with audiences, telling a story that was both heartbreaking and full of a kind of magical realism.
His portrayal of John Coffey was, in a way, simply remarkable. He managed to convey such deep emotion and vulnerability, even with his imposing physical presence. It was a performance that truly touched people's hearts and, you know, earned him widespread critical acclaim. This role was so powerful that it led to his nomination for a prestigious award, which is a big deal for any actor. It really cemented his place as a serious talent in Hollywood.
The story in "The Green Mile" follows John Coffey, a man condemned to death, as he arrives at a prison's death row. His presence there changes the lives of the guards and other prisoners in truly unexpected ways. Michael Clarke Duncan brought a kind of quiet dignity and immense compassion to the character, making him someone viewers could deeply connect with and feel for. It was, honestly, a role that showcased his incredible range and ability to bring complex characters to life, even with very few words.
Even today, years after its release, "The Green Mile" remains a beloved film, and Michael Clarke Duncan's performance as John Coffey is a major reason why. It's a testament to his skill and the emotional depth he could bring to a character, which is something very special. This film, basically, ensured his place in cinematic history, and people still talk about it, you know, pretty often.
His Physical Presence and That Famous Height
One of the most striking things about Michael Clarke Duncan was, without a doubt, his physical size. People often ask about "michael clarke duncan längd" because it was such a noticeable part of his persona. He stood at an impressive 6 feet 4 ¼ inches tall, or 193.7 centimeters. This height, truly, made him stand out in any crowd, and especially on the big screen.
His stature wasn't just about height; he also had a very broad and powerful build. This combination gave him an imposing presence that, in some respects, made him perfect for certain types of roles. He could play the intimidating figure, but what was truly special was how he often used that size to portray characters with a gentle soul or a surprising vulnerability, which is that a pretty cool trick for an actor.
For example, in "The Green Mile," his height and build were crucial to the character of John Coffey. It emphasized the contrast between his physical appearance and his inner innocence. This visual element, in a way, added so much to the story and to how audiences perceived his character. It made John Coffey even more memorable and, you know, quite unique.
His physical presence also contributed to his ability to play a variety of roles, from the tough guy to the gentle giant. It gave him a certain gravitas, a kind of weight that made his characters feel very real and impactful. So, his "längd" or height, was not just a fact about him; it was an integral part of his identity as an actor, and really, a big part of why he was so good at what he did.

Common Questions About Michael Clarke Duncan
How tall was Michael Clarke Duncan?
Michael Clarke Duncan was, actually, quite tall. He stood at 6 feet 4 ¼ inches, which is about 193.7 centimeters. His height was a pretty noticeable part of his physical presence, and it certainly contributed to his imposing, yet often gentle, screen persona.
What was Michael Clarke Duncan's most famous role?
His most famous and, arguably, most impactful role was that of John Coffey in the film "The Green Mile." This performance, honestly, earned him widespread critical acclaim and a major award nomination. It's the role that most people remember him for, and for good reason.
When did Michael Clarke Duncan pass away and at what age?
Michael Clarke Duncan passed away on September 3, 2012. He was 54 years old at the time of his passing. His death was due to natural causes, following a heart attack he had suffered in July of that same year. It was a really sad day for many, as a matter of fact.
